How Common Is The Last Name Danac? popularity and diffusion
The surname is the 899,940th most frequently used last name throughout the world, borne by approximately 1 in 24,537,192 people. The surname Danac is predominantly found in Europe, where 50 percent of Danac are found; 49 percent are found in Eastern Europe and 48 percent are found in Romanian Europe. It is also the 1,223,525th most commonly used first name globally. It is borne by 64 people.
This last name is most frequently used in Romania, where it is borne by 142 people, or 1 in 141,393. In Romania it is most prevalent in: Teleorman County, where 42 percent live, Ilfov County, where 31 percent live and Prahova County, where 25 percent live. Besides Romania it is found in 6 countries. It is also found in The Philippines, where 38 percent live and India, where 11 percent live.
